Northampton Business Directory is looking for motivated individuals for a Customer Service Sales role, where you'll join a door-to-door sales team in the United Kingdom. You'll actively engage with potential customers at their homes, promote a doorstep delivery service, and record orders using a CRM system.
This permanent contract offers weekly pay, full training, and opportunities for additional commission through sales and retention bonuses. Ideal for those who enjoy being active and engaging with the community.

How to prepare for a job interview at Northampton Business Directory
✨Know the Product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you understand the doorstep delivery service you'll be promoting. Research the benefits and features so you can confidently discuss how it meets customer needs. This will show your enthusiasm and preparedness.
✨Practice Your Pitch
Since this role involves engaging with customers directly, practice your sales pitch. Role-play with a friend or family member to refine your approach. Focus on being friendly and approachable, as these qualities are key in door-to-door sales.
✨Show Your Community Spirit
Highlight any previous experience you have in community engagement or customer service. Employers love candidates who are passionate about connecting with their local area. Share examples of how you've positively impacted your community in the past.
✨Be Ready for CRM Questions
Familiarise yourself with basic CRM systems, as you'll need to record orders efficiently. Be prepared to discuss any relevant experience you have with technology or data entry, even if it's from a different context. This will demonstrate your adaptability.
